REGION
RESTARTS
As you begin reconnecting regions, you may notice an
initial failure when trying to teleport to them.
You
may need to purge the region using your login to the osgrid.org website, then
restart the region itself in order to fully reconnect it after the outage.
INVENTORY
AND ASSETS
While we have done large amount of testing already, there
may still be an issue here or there with specific assets.
In
our testing so far, the few asset glitches found do not indicate a problem with
the asset recovery, new asset cluster, or new FSassets service.
Initial
investigation points to small data changes or format issues present with
specific assets before the outage which are now found by the XML serializer.
If
you see widespread issues, please report them - but also try to have patience as
we may be swamped for a while getting everything fully rolling for everyone
again.
